Based on a zooarchaeological corpus from five high-status sites located in the middle Loire valley, this paper aims to confirm or relativise the criterious traditionally used to identify food habits of elites in the end of "premier Moyen Âge". Thus, first analysed elements are proportions and slaughter patterns of domestic triad (cattle, pig and caprines) as well as the part played by poultry and wild species in the meat diet. Associated with these quantitative criteria are qualitative criteria concerning faunal diversity, the presence of rare species (peacock, bear, sturgeon) and, to a lesser extent, the part played by aquatic ressources (fishes and molluscs).
